The Pakistani Navy has received a second Chinese-built F-22P frigate, PNS Shamsher.

PNS Shamsher, which was commissioned in Shanghai in December 2009, is the second of four F-22P warships built by the navy in collaboration with China.

The construction of the third ship at Hudong Zhonghua Shipyard in Shanghai is also nearing completion and is expected to be delivered to Pakistan in the third quarter of 2010.

According to Pakistani naval sources, work on the fourth ship is progressing well at the Karachi Shipyard under a transfer of technology contract. It is expected to be complete by 2013.
